Hudson Valley Business Owner Sentenced For Stealing From Clients A Westchester County businessman will spend time behind bars after admitting to lining his own pockets with hundreds of thousands of dollars as part of a scheme to steal business taxes from clients that employed his services. Pleasantville resident Stefan Malgarinos, 48, has been sentenced to prison time after pleading guilty to grand larceny and scheme to defraud, both felonies, related to stealing withholding tax money from state and federal authorities collected from his clients. New Victims Say Area Car Salesman Stole From Them, Police Say Several new victims have come forward with claims that a Middletown car salesman previously working as a realtor stole cash from them. Michael Edison Ramos, 34, of Middletown has been charged with multiple felonies after allegedly stealing numerous cash down payments. State Police investigators are now looking for victims who may have dealt with Ramos while he acted as a realtor in the Middletown area. Alert Issued For Driveway Paving Scam Area residents are being warned of a driveway paving scam. Several incidents had been reported in the Rochester area last summer, resulting in the arrests of several persons on charges of “Scheme to Defraud.” Late last week, the Putnam County Sheriff’s Office received a complaint from a resident in Garrison reporting an incident. On Tuesday, April 2, two white men approached the homeowner at his residence and identified themselves as being from a paving company, Putnam County Sheriff Robert L.
